/// <summary>
/// Determines whether a word occurrence is in the collection.
/// </summary>
/// <param name="word">The word.</param>
/// <param name="firstCharIndex">The index of the first character.</param>
/// <returns><c>True</c> if the collection contains the occurrence, <c>false</c> otherwise.</returns>
public bool ContainsOccurrence(string word, int firstCharIndex) {
if(string.IsNullOrEmpty(word)) return false;
if(firstCharIndex < 0) return false;
foreach(WordInfo w in items) {
if(w.Text == word && w.FirstCharIndex == firstCharIndex) return true;
}
return false;
}
